Earlier this year, there was a push by anti-gun groups to pass some draconian magazine bans at the state level.






For example, in CT, there was a bill on the table to ban the possession of any magazine (or ammo links) with greater than ten round capacity.  This bill was an outright ban - you would have had to get rid of them without any compensation or face felony charges.  Similar bills cropped up in MD, NY, and VA, IIRC.  







The CT bill was monkeystomped after several hundred pissed off gun owners showed up in person to testify against it and likely thousands more bombarded legislators with e-mails.




Several prominent (and ordinarily anti-gun) dem state lawmakers saw the light and actually changed their minds on voting for bill.







This happened in arguably the bluest of blue states, albeit at a good time (post-Heller and McDonald).







Therefore, you should have hope that none of this shit will pass muster at the federal level.  Knock on wood.
